Swordale

(Suardale, Suardail)
Western Isles

A crofting township in the southwest of the Eye Peninsula on the Isle of Lewis in the Outer Hebrides, Swordale (also Suardale, Gael: Suardail) lies immediately to the south of Knock and 2 miles (3 km) southwest of Garrabost. The settlement overlooks Loch Braigh na h-Aoidhe and the narrow isthmus which connects the peninsula to the majority of Lewis.
